{"id":11020,"date":"2021-04-14T03:56:17","date_gmt":"2021-04-14T03:56:17","guid":{"rendered":"http:\/\/www.16news.com.au\/?p=11020"},"modified":"2021-04-14T03:56:17","modified_gmt":"2021-04-14T03:56:17","slug":"small-business-rebate-scheme-kicks-off-2","status":"publish","type":"post","link":"http:\/\/www.16news.com.au\/index.php\/2021\/04\/14\/small-business-rebate-scheme-kicks-off-2\/","title":{"rendered":"SMALL BUSINESS REBATE SCHEME KICKS OFF"},"content":{"rendered":"<p>Small businesses are encouraged to sign up for a new $1500 rebate scheme to help cover the cost of NSW and local government fees and charges.<br \/>\nTreasurer Dominic Perrottet said the Small Business Fees and Charges Rebate was designed to benefit tens of thousands of small businesses across the state as NSW continues its post-pandemic recovery.<br \/>\n\u201cOur November Budget committed nearly $500 million to this rebate, which will leave more money in the pockets of eligible small businesses, sole traders and non-profit organisations,\u201d Mr Perrottet said.<br \/>\n\u201cSmall businesses are the lifeblood of our economy and supporting them equals supporting jobs. I encourage all eligible operators to register for the $1500 credit with Service NSW.\u201d<br \/>\nMinister for Digital and Minister for Customer Service Victor Dominello said claiming the rebate would be simple and could be done online.<br \/>\n\u201cLiquor licences, food authority licences, council rates and outdoor seating fees are just a few examples of the fees and charges that can be claimed back through this rebate scheme,\u201d Mr Dominello said.<br \/>\n\u201cSmall businesses who have total wages below the new 2020-21 $1.2 million payroll tax threshold, and have a turnover of at least $75,000 per year, will be able to register through their MyServiceNSW account and claim back eligible state and local government fees and changes.\u201d<br \/>\nMinister for Finance and Small Business Damien Tudehope said the launch of the rebate scheme coincided with a number of licence waivers coming to an end.<br \/>\n\u201cIt\u2019s so important that we continue to support the small businesses of NSW,\u201d Mr Tudehope said.<br \/>\n\u201cSmall businesses are the backbone of their communities and we want to make it easier for them to run a business and get ahead.\u201d<br \/>\nThe rebate will be available until 30 June 2022.
